CONDITION
This 1979 Pontiac Trans Am is a beautiful and well-preserved example finished in a stunning Atlantis Blue exterior paired with an Oyster White interior. With just 46,000 miles, this Trans Am is equipped with the highly desirable Pontiac 400 V8 engine and a factory 4-speed manual transmission—an increasingly rare and sought-after combination.

The car is well optioned with power steering, power brakes, power windows, power locks, factory air conditioning, T-tops, and a rear defroster. Mechanically, it runs strong and drives very well, maintaining the muscular performance and iconic presence expected from a late-70s Trans Am.

Cosmetically, the car shows beautifully with a glossy Blue finish and a clean White interior. As with many Trans Am of this era, the car does have one common flaw—a crack in the dash. Aside from that typical issue, the car presents extremely well and retains excellent curb appeal.

A rare 400 / 4-speed Atlantis Blue Trans Am with low miles and great options—ready for shows, cruising, and collectability.
